Webb23 okt. 2024 · To find the probability of SAT scores in your sample exceeding 1380, you first find the z -score. The mean of our distribution is 1150, and the standard deviation is 150. The z -score tells you how many standard deviations away 1380 is from the mean. For a z -score of 1.53, the p -value is 0.937.

Now, I am interested to integrate the PDF numerically using Montecarlo method. Webb14 Chapter 1 Sets and Probability Empty Set The empty set, written as /0or{}, is the set with no elements. The empty set can be used to conveniently indicate that an equation has no solution. For example {x xis real and x2 =−1}= 0/ By the definition of subset, given any set A, we must have 0/ ⊆A.
